    Bf and I drove up for Halloween weekend/ ODU vs JMU game, and decided to grab breakfast before the drive back down to VB and this place was great! Super quiet, out of the way location, and so there wasn't a wait or long line at 11am on a Sunday morning. The menu offers lattes and smoothies, breakfast foods and lunch foods, so even if you're not wanting one you can get the other. Our food came out within 5 minutes of sitting down and there's both indoor and outdoor seating. There were like 5-6 baristas when we walked up to the register and they seemed knowledgable of their menu and offerings. They recommended their White Chocolate and Raspberry Cake over the Caramel Pound Cake since I was between both and it was so good. Loved the avocado toast, a very fresh and light meal that was filling for one person. The Loaded Logan was also very tasty, my bf demolished it quickly. The atmosphere was friendly, easy going, and just a good spot for chit chat with friends. You could come here to study but maybe not during busy rushes as it gets a little loud with everyone talking. Would love to be back here when we visit again- 10/10 experience!

    This place is such a cute little spot on the outside of town. It's family owned and there is outside seating!! It's on the new mall strip at the corner of spotswood and Rockingham park. You have a great view of a nice field and the Massanutten mountain. They have a good options of breakfast items that are affordable and tasteful and a specialty menu for coffee and smoothies! The interior design of the establishment is very planned out. There is a nice contrast of white, black and green. There is a lot of plant life in the building that makes the inside feel spacious. There are even board games if you plan on staying for a longer visit. With it being a family owned business, the service is very nice and friendly and they make you feel extremely welcomed. If you're looking for a nice coffee shop to go to that isn't frequently visited by college students but still give a great assortment of options, I'd recommend coming to crossroads!

    My friends and I went to Afton this past weekend for a quick getaway. Before the trip, I did some…read moreresearch on local coffee roasters, and Happ Coffee was easily at the top of my list. On our way to our Airbnb, a friend and I stopped by Happ, which is located inside an industrial-style building that's incredibly spacious. There's plenty of seating, along with a dedicated area where beans are available for purchase. The barista was really friendly, and we ended up having an in-depth conversation about drink recommendations. When I settled on a cappuccino, he walked me through how each milk option paired with the espresso. I ultimately chose whole milk since it doesn't have an overpowering flavor like almond milk, which allowed the light-roast espresso (an optional upgrade) to really shine. I didn't fully enjoy the cappuccino during the first couple sips because the mouthfeel of the whole milk felt a bit too thick, which didn't pair well with the light roast. However, it became more harmonious as I continued drinking, and the highlight was definitely the bright sweetness of the espresso. I really appreciate a coffee shop that pulls a light-roast espresso well. The barista asked for my thoughts, which I shared, and he then pulled me a shot using their South Paw (house espresso blend) beans to try. I thoroughly enjoyed this light-medium espresso, which was bright and strong, without the unpleasant acidity or bitterness that often follows. I don't typically recommend ordering a straight espresso shot at most coffee shops, but Happ does it well. Overall, it was a great experience -- lovely coffee and friendly baristas who genuinely care about their craft. I left with one of their limited-release coffees (a Peruvian Geisha), which I'm looking forward to trying as a pour-over at home.
